e. Fraud Detection & Market Surveillance
Market abuse—including insider trading, spoofing, manipulation, and fraudulent transactions—is hard to detect using rule-based systems alone.
AI enhances surveillance by:
- Identifying unusual trading patterns
- Detecting behavior inconsistent with historical norms
- Spotting coordinated activity across multiple accounts
- Monitoring digital communication channels
Regulators and exchanges increasingly use AI to monitor market integrity and detect suspicious behavior faster.
f. Regulatory and Supervisory Technology (RegTech & SupTech)
Regulators themselves are turning to AI to improve oversight. This includes:
- Automated monitoring of broker-dealer activity
- Real-time risk alerts
- Analysis of disclosures and filings
- Automated compliance checks
- Pattern recognition in market behavior
AI-enabled supervision (SupTech) increases the ability of regulators to protect market integrity while reducing manual workload.

4. Risks and Challenges of AI in Finance
While AI offers major benefits, it also introduces significant challenges that must be managed responsibly.
a. Bias and Fairness Problems
AI systems learn from historical data. If this data reflects biased patterns, the models may replicate or amplify those biases.
Examples include:
- Biased credit scoring
- Unequal investment recommendations
- Skewed risk assessments
Fairness audits and bias detection frameworks are essential.
b. Lack of Explainability
Many AI models—especially deep learning systems—are difficult to interpret.
Financial institutions must be able to explain:
- How decisions are made
- What factors influenced predictions
- Why a client was given a particular risk rating
Explainability is critical for investor trust and regulatory compliance.
c. Model Risks
AI systems may fail due to:
- Incorrect training data
- Overfitting
- Poor parameter settings
- Changing market conditions
- Systemic correlations between models
Model governance teams must continuously validate and audit AI systems.
d. Cybersecurity Concerns
AI introduces new attack surfaces:
- Model manipulation
- Data poisoning
- Adversarial attacks
- Unauthorized access to training data
Institutions require strong security protocols to safeguard AI systems.
e. Over-reliance on Automation
If too many institutions use similar AI models, markets may become:
- More correlated
- More volatile
- More fragile during stress
Hybrid systems—where humans retain oversight—are essential.
